[Pkg-emacsen-addons] Bug#847690: dh-elpa: better handling of `deftheme' themes

Dmitry Bogatov KAction at gnu.org
Thu Dec 15 02:12:28 UTC 2016


[2016-12-13 11:23] Sean Whitton <spwhitton at spwhitton.name>
>
> part 1     text/plain                1709
> Hello Dmitry,
>
> You CCed your message to <submit at bugs.debian.org> instead of
> <847690 at bugs.debian.org>.  I've resent it for you.  Please check To,Cc
> carefully!

Sorry. Will make some automatic check one day.

> On Tue, Dec 13, 2016 at 01:53:00PM +0300, Dmitry Bogatov wrote:
> > I see two actions we can perform to improve our situation.
> >
> >  1. Install README.Debian file by dh-elpa if we detect that package is
> >     theme and no README.Debian is already provided. If README.Debian is
> >     provided, we can grep it for 'package-initialize', to ensure that
> >     it mentions this issue.
>
> As I said in another thread, I don't think we should implement code to
> merge a note into README.Debian when this is at best a temporary
> solution.  Too many edge cases.

Fine. I agree, that fixing limitation is better then documenting it.

> >  2. We can advice #'load-theme. Something like this:
> >  [...]
> Thank you very much for this code snippet.  dh_elpa could add it to the
> emacsen-startup script for a theme package.  I'll look into implementing
> this towards the end of this month.

Ok.

-- 
X-Web-Site: https://sinsekvu.github.io | Note that I process my email in batch,
Accept-Languages: eo,ru,en             | at most once every 24 hours. If matter
Accept: text/plain, text/x-diff        | is urgent, you have my phone number.
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 819 bytes
Desc: not available
URL: <http://lists.alioth.debian.org/pipermail/pkg-emacsen-addons/attachments/20161215/020d0be1/attachment.sig>


More information about the Pkg-emacsen-addons mailing list